| Gaia: | The struggle to eradicate poverty and economic and social inequalities in both the rural, marginal urban and urban sectors has been incessant. The initiatives, programs, projects for this objective have not been allowed to wait, so much so that international organizations such as the UN raised as Millennium Goal N.1, Reduce poverty by half, between 1990 and 2015 worldwide. In our country we have the National Development Plan 2007-2010 and the National Plan 2009-2013 with the content of the 12 National Objectives for Good Living. Most of the decentralized autonomous governments in the development plans, their vision is to improve the quality of life of the inhabitants. With this brief analysis we deduce that the development plans have become a useful tool that becomes an effective guide for the work of local governments, with mechanisms for participation, control, monitoring, and citizen oversight. A new way of conceiving development is based on the use of potential, own resources and the person as human capital and generator of growth. |
